Studies on CMOS Down-Converter with Double-Balanced Mixer along with Balun at S-Band

Abstract
A CMOS down-converter with the combination of Gilbert Cell mixer and modified low voltage design technique using LC-balun is demonstrated in this paper. This forms a down-converter duo of mixer and balun. The RF, LO, and IF port frequencies are 3 GHz, 2.4GHz, and 600MHz, respectively. The measurement results of the proposed mixer-balun duo exhibit 13dB of conversion gain, -7.9 dBm of Input 1-dB compression point (P1dB), 2.51 dBm of Input 3rd order intercept point (IIP3), 3.8 dBm of Output 3rd order intercept point (OIP3) -43dB RF-IF, -42dB LO_IF Isolation and 1.2V supply voltage. This mixer-balun duo was fabricated at 65nm. CMOS technology. It can provide a 4 dB conversion gain even without connecting the LC-balun and 1.2V supply voltage is utilized.
